Job description

Culture is everything! Come and work for an amazing team greeting and registering patients in a busy Urgent Care setting. We are looking for a Full time staff member to add to our Boulder clinic on Pearl St. Reliability is a must!


AFC Urgent Care of Boulder is seeking a front desk medical receptionist with excellent customer service skills for a full time position. The ideal candidate will be personable, efficient, and able to address customer concerns/complaints with a positive caring attitude. Must be able to work a 12 hours shift. Open clinic hours are Monday-Friday 8-8 and Saturday-Sunday 8-5.  Must be able to multitask as this is a high paced position. Please see job description below and respond to schedule an interview.


  • Prepare the clinic for opening each day by reviewing the facility, opening all systems applications, and preparing new patient registration packets and required documents
  • Greet patients, assist with patients registration on the iPad. 
  • Register patients, update patient records, and verify insurance accurately and timely
  • Respond promptly to customer needs, provide excellent customer service, assist patients with follow-up appointments, and fulfill medical documentation requests
  • Balance daily patient charges (cash, check, credit cards) against system reports
  • Complete closing procedures by preparing closing documentation and submitting required reports
  • Prepare, sign, and drop the deposit in the safe on a nightly basis
  • Complete cash control procedures and secure financial assets
  • Maintain complete and accurate documentation.
  • Observe safety and security procedures; promote a safe and pleasant work environment
  • Regular attendance to ensure efficient clinic operations
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ned
